#b197f0 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#b197f0 is composed of 69.4% red, 59.2% green and 94.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 26.3% cyan, 37.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 5.9% black. It has a hue angle of 257.5 degrees, a saturation of 74.8% and a lightness of 76.7%. #b197f0 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#632fe1. Closest websafe color is: #9999ff.

Shades and Tints of #b197f0

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060210 is the darkest color, while #fefeff is the lightest one.

Tones of #b197f0

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#c2c0c7 is the less saturated color, while #ab89fe is the most saturated one.
